3. Key Features

  • Provides simultaneous measurements and logs up to 4 channels.
  • Supports various wiring systems.
  • World's fastest class speed at 200ms interval for leakage current measurement.
  • Offers both traditional leakage / load current measurements.
  • Large graphic display and magnet on the back case to attach it on metal enclosures.
  • Bluetooth communication for IoT applications.

6. Operating Instructions

6.1. Power On/Off

Press and hold the POWER button to turn the unit on or off.

6.2. Measurement Modes

The KEW 5050 can measure various electrical parameters:

  • Io: Leakage current (1st-order component of Iom)
  • Ior: Resistive leakage current
  • Iom: Leakage current with harmonics
  • R: Insulation resistance (determined by V and Ior)
  • V: Reference voltage (1st-order component of Vm)
  • f: Frequency

Use the navigation buttons (UP/DOWN/LEFT/RIGHT) and ENTER button to select and configure measurement parameters.

6.3. Data Logging

To start logging data, press the START/STOP button. Press it again to stop logging. Logged data is saved to the SD card.

6.4. Data Transfer and Analysis

Connect the KEW 5050 to a PC using the USB cable. Use the KEW Windows software to download, view, and analyze the logged data. The software supports automatic generation of graphs and reports.

8. Troubleshooting

ProblemPossible CauseSolution
Unit does not power onDead or incorrectly installed batteriesReplace batteries, ensuring correct polarity.
No readings displayedIncorrect sensor connection or faulty leadsCheck all connections. Ensure leads are not damaged.
Data not saving to SD cardSD card full, corrupted, or incorrectly insertedCheck SD card capacity. Reinsert or try a different SD card. Format if necessary (data will be lost).
Inaccurate measurementsImproper setup, environmental interference, or calibration neededReview setup instructions. Avoid strong magnetic fields. Consider professional calibration.

If the problem persists after attempting these solutions, contact KYORITSU customer support.
